Book Review: God’s Power to Change Your Life by Rick Warren

I have been a fan of Pastor Rick Warren since he first wrote the best-selling book The Purpose Driven Life (2002). I believe that God has had His hand over that man and his ministry since he began Saddleback Church in the late 1990’s. 

This book is a re-publish of a small book Rick wrote in 1990 called The Power to Change Your Life. I haven’t read that book, but I find it very interesting that he changed the title to reflect God’s power and not our power. That is the message conveyed in this book, that God wants us to obey Him and rely fully upon the Holy Spirit to change us from within to become what He wants us to be for His glory. It emphasizes basic Christian principles like prayer, discipline, bible study and community support.

In typical Warren style, the book is very easy to read and hard to put down. It has very little “fluff” and is chocked-full of biblical references supporting the chapter titles. 

This is a book you want to give to people who are battling depression or have a poor self-image to help lift them up. It will gently guide them to their Creator and help them to understand who they really are in the eyes of God.

Not surprisingly, I give this book a full 5.0 out of 5.0 for its message and usefulness.
